Surgeon Headlamp

Description of Surgeon Headlamp:

In any surgical procedure, good illumination is crucial for the surgeon to be able to see the surgical field clearly and perform the procedure with precision. Headlights have been a crucial tool for surgeons for decades, and with the advent of new technology, headlight surgical has become an even more important aspect of modern surgical practice.

A headlight surgical is a specialized lighting device that is designed to provide high-intensity light directly onto the surgical field, enabling the surgeon to see more clearly and perform surgery with greater accuracy.

Uses of Surgeon Headlamp:

  • Neurosurgery: Headlight surgical is often used in neurosurgical procedures, where precise visualization of the surgical field is crucial.
  • Orthopedic surgery: In orthopedic surgery, headlight surgical is often used to improve visualization of the surgical field and to reduce the risk of accidental damage to surrounding tissues.
  • Ophthalmic surgery: Headlight surgical is commonly used in ophthalmic surgery to provide clear illumination of the surgical field and to improve surgical outcomes.
  • Cardiothoracic surgery: Headlight surgical is often used in cardiothoracic surgery to improve visualization of the surgical field and to reduce the risk of complications.
  • General surgery: Headlight surgical is used in many types of general surgery, including abdominal surgery, urologic surgery, and gynecologic surgery, to provide clear illumination of the surgical field and to improve surgical outcomes.

Features of Surgeon Headlamp:

  • High-intensity light: Headlight surgical is designed to provide a high-intensity beam of light that is focused directly onto the surgical field, providing clear illumination for the surgeon.
  • Lightweight and ergonomic design: Headlight surgical is designed to be lightweight and easy to wear, with an ergonomic design that ensures maximum comfort for the surgeon during long surgical procedures.
  • Cordless operation: Many headlight surgical devices are now cordless, providing greater freedom of movement for the surgeon during surgery.
  • Adjustable brightness: Headlight surgical often comes with adjustable brightness settings, allowing the surgeon to adjust the intensity of the light as needed.
  • Long battery life: Cordless headlight surgical devices often have long battery life, ensuring that the surgeon can complete long surgical procedures without needing to change batteries.

Types of Surgeon Headlamp:

Here are several types of headlight surgical devices available on the market, each with its own unique features and benefits.

  1. Corded Headlight Surgical: Corded headlight surgical devices are powered by a cord that connects the device to a power source. These devices are often less expensive than cordless models and are commonly used in surgical settings where access to a power source is readily available.
  2. Cordless Headlight Surgical: Cordless headlight surgical devices are powered by rechargeable batteries and do not require a power source. These devices are often more expensive than corded models, but offer greater freedom of movement and flexibility during surgery.
  3. LED Headlight Surgical: LED headlight surgical devices use light-emitting diodes (LEDs) to provide high-intensity illumination. These devices are often more energy-efficient and longer-lasting than traditional incandescent bulbs.
  4. Halogen Headlight Surgical: Halogen headlight surgical devices use halogen bulbs to provide high-intensity illumination. These devices are often less expensive than LED models but may not last as long and may be less energy-efficient.
  5. Xenon Headlight Surgical: Xenon headlight surgical devices use xenon bulbs to provide high-intensity illumination. These devices are often more expensive than halogen models but offer brighter and more natural-looking light.
  6. Fiberoptic Headlight Surgical: Fiberoptic headlight surgical devices use a fiberoptic cable to transmit light from an external light source to the surgical field. These devices are often more lightweight and comfortable to wear than other types of headlight surgical but require an external light source to function.
